Scanian War The Scanian War ( Skånske Krig , Skånska kriget , Schonischer Krieg ) was a part of the Northern Wars involving the union of Denmark–Norway, Brandenburg and Sweden.It was fought from 1675 to 1679 mainly on Scanian soil, in the former Danish provinces along the border with Sweden, and in Northern Germany.
